  • Abstract
    The purpose of this study is to improve rescue radar system with array antennas so that it can quickly identify far-off survivors under rubble. Authors focused on time-variable elements from the respiration of a survivor awaiting rescue in order to remove clutter components, such as the rubble. Authors propose the method which identifies the location of the survivor in three dimension by using the two dimensional array antennas. The experimental results of measurement for subjects location by the proposed method agreed with the actual location of the subjects.
